: Elemental spirits (Earth, Air, Fire, Water, Wood, and Metal) inhabit the world. Most Alerans bond with these furies to perform "furycrafting," granting them supernatural abilities like enhanced strength, flight, or healing.

Furies of Calderon (2004) is the first novel in the series by Jim Butcher . The series famously originated from a bet that Butcher could not write a successful story based on two "bad" ideas: the Lost Roman Legion and Pokémon .
